'''''Cinchona officinalis''''' ('''Quinine Bark''') is a tree native to [[Amazon Rainforest]] [[vegetation]]. This plant is used for the production of [[quinine]], which is an anti-fever agent especially useful in the prevention and treatment of [[malaria]]. There are a number of various other chemicals which are made from this tree, and they include [[cinchonine]], [[cinchonidine]] and [[quinidine]].
